Signs and symptoms associated with a pc that requirements computer registry first aid most often break up into two groups: speed and performance. The very first category, speed, might take many forms. Your computer might take forever and a day to start up or to shut down. Likewise, computer software programs, like Internet Explorer or Microsoft Word, may take long time to open and close. Eventually, your internet browser may be taking longer and longer to load internet pages, download computer files, or even play songs or videos.
The second kind of sign indicating your computer could have to have registry first aid can be your personal computer’s overall performance. This includes warning signs or error messages, primarily types that advise you a specific computer file (usually a .DLL file) is missing or maybe damaged. Your computer programs may lock up or stop working. Even worse, your whole computer may begin to freeze, quit, or arbitrarily restart. The worst of all is the hated Blue Screen of Death, anytime your computer suddenly cuts to a blue computer screen which includes a cryptic error message in white text, and must have to end up being rebooted.
Each one of these problems might well have a number of completely different factors, a number of which might not be linked to the computer system registry. Slower world wide web browsing, as an example, may end up being due to a sluggish internet connection and could have nothing to do with your pc. Software and computer crashes may possibly be due to faulty equipment or perhaps not an adequate amount of computer memory. Computer registry repair software programs employs computer system registry first aid in couple of distinctive ways: cleaning and fixing. To start off, it cleans your computer system registry. Over time, because of just common computer system use, installing and getting rid of software programs, setting up different hardware, and so on., your pc’s registry accumulates quite a lot of trash. This includes outdated records, duplicate items, and in some cases blank records. Because your computer system needs to use the registry for nearly each and every operation it performs, going through a large registry to look through every single time can slow your pc’s overall performance significantly.
Pc registry first aid software programs look through your entire computer registry trying to find these kinds of junk file types, and then simply removing all of them. This tends to make your registry more compact, your computer’s search times speedier, and results in an all-around faster and even more efficient computer overall performance.
The other thing pc registry first aid software programs will do is fix your registry. Over time, critical computer file types in your computer system may become digitally damaged just due to routine usage. As you transfer files around on your computer system, links in between file types can get damaged or even deleted.
A registry first aid program will scan for damaged file types, and repair them if it turns out it finds any. It will verify each of the links between computer files, and fix any that are broken. By and large, this will make your computer run much more smoothly and efficiently. Hopefully, it will also eliminate warnings and error messages which keep showing up on your computer screen, in particular the one telling you that a particular .DLL computer file is corrupted or even missing.
